The Hamilton Construction Company Data Breach: Reported Filing Facts
Hamilton Construction Company is a commercial and residential construction firm that manages complex projects, employee payroll, and subcontractor documentation. As part of its standard business operations, the company collects and stores sensitive personal information, including employee Social Security numbers, tax documentation, banking details for direct deposit, and government-issued identification. In 2025, the company officially reported a data security incident to the Oregon Attorney General, confirming that unauthorized parties may have accessed internal systems containing this sensitive data. If you have received a formal data breach notification letter from Hamilton Construction Company, it indicates that your personal information was likely stored within the affected systems. What to do if you were affected
These general steps can help limit the risk of identity theft and fraud after any data breach.
Stay alert to targeted scams
Be cautious of calls, texts, or emails that reference this breach. Legitimate organizations won't ask you to confirm sensitive details through an unsolicited message.
Keep your notification letter
Save the notice you received. It documents that your information was involved and is often needed to enroll in any credit monitoring offered or to join a related legal claim.
